Europa League : Arsenal set for Sporting Lisbon clash

Arsenal will move to Estadio Jose Alvalade to face Sporting Lisbon to continue their Europa League campaign on Thursday, when Manchester city rivals Chelsea will host BATE Borisov of Belarus.



Arsenal and Sporting sit on six points apiece after two games, with Azerbaijan's Qarabag and fellow strugglers Vorskla of Ukraine still pointless.


Sporting are fifth in Portugal's top flight, four points off the top with former Manchester United star Nani having scored three goals from seven league outings.




If Arsenal needed more reason to believe in their chances of going all the way, they need not look far. As coach of Sevilla in 2013-2016, Emery led the Spaniards to three consecutive Europa League titles.


Emery stated after a 3-1 win over Leicester City on Monday in which Mesut Ozil scored and provided an assist in a man-of-the-match performance :


"We are beginning to play with heart, I think we played some sexy football."
